ECHN an extraordinary community healthcare system comprised of two highly respected acute-care hospitals (Manchester Memorial and Rockville General) with approximately 500 physicians and advanced practitioners. ECHN hospital and outpatient practice sites feature leading technology, a skilled/subacute facility, multiple outpatient services centers and a state-of-the-art cancer center. Top talent experienced faculty physicians support ECHN’s prominent family medicine residency program. ECHN has the latest in robotic surgical systems, including the new MAKO robotic assisted knee/hip replacement system and the Xi da Vinci robot, the Women’s Center for Wellness named one of best Mammogram Imaging Centers by The Women’s Choice Award, including a new Canon Vantage Orian Magnetic Resonance Imaging machine. ECHN new partnership with Jefferson Radiology provides new and expanded comprehensive diagnostic/radiology services along with many other highly regarded programs.
